The key is lack of participation by the amateur community in general. Only 
real enthusiasts operate the contests.


I would definitely have to agree with us.  Logic would tell us that there 
should be more participation on the VHF/UHF bands then there used to be, 
given the availablity and cost of all mode rigs combining HF/6m/2m/70cm. Now 
6m activity has really increased over what it used to be, but I think that 
2m and 70cm has decreased since I started VHF contesting in the mid 80s. I 
saw a FT100D for sale today for $425.  Who would have dreamed 15 years ago 
of getting on 6m with 100 watts, 2m with 50 watts and 432 with 20 watts for 
$425?  In a box smaller than the TR9130 I used to have?

I would be willing to bet that 75% of Icom 706/7000, Yaesu FT100/857/897 
owners have never used the 2m and 70cm portion of their rigs on anything 
other than FM.  How do we change this?
